Spiritual to Physical: Let There Be Light!
Skarbutt ^ | 07/28/2021 | Skarbutt

Posted on 07/28/2021 9:02:10 AM PDT by inpajamas

“The wind bloweth where it listeth, and thou hearest the sound thereof, but canst not tell whence it cometh, and whither it goeth: so is every one that is born of the Spirit." (John 3:8)

In John 3:8, Jesus relates the moving of the wind to the moving of the spirit. Jesus always taught with parables, using physical things which God created. He spoke of sheep, wolves, crops, and many things the people understood and by them he expressed spiritual truths made manifest through God’s creation.

We can understand spiritual things by our observations of physical and visible things. Invisible things support the existence of all things that exist physically. Indeed, for if we understand ideas can spur actions that lead to the creations of things we make or build, then it stands to reason that comprehending a creation can lead to us back with a better understanding of the invisible things that spawned them.

For all matter, and energy for that matter, including all living and nonliving things, are visible reflections in a “mirror” reveling spiritual things we cannot see with the eye. Indeed, for all created things were preceded by their possibility of being before they existed. All things that exist physically must have a foundation of spiritual axioms (physical and spiritual laws) after which they are patterned in order to be brought into being. This made them possible to exist before they existed.

So then, beginning with invisible things, by comprehension of invisible ideas, mankind has made many things which are now visible—everything we make begins first with an idea. So likewise, by comprehending things that are visible, we can also understand that which lies outside of the material dimension.

Was this then a purpose and intent of God in the creation of all things, that we might learn and understand the invisible things which were before and lie beyond our physical realm? Indeed! As Paul says in Romans 1:20 - “For the invisible things of him from the creation of the world are clearly seen, being understood by the things that are made, even his eternal power and Godhead; so that they are without excuse”.

And the spoken Word at the beginning, “LET THERE BE LIGHT”, has a far more profound meaning than most realize. For Light is Knowledge, as Darkness is ignorance. As it is written, God divided the Light (Knowledge, Wisdom, and Understanding), from the Darkness (ignorance and falsities); for God saw the Light, that it was good. For it was not at the beginning, but later on, on the fourth day that the physical luminaries providing light (the Sun, Moon, and stars) appeared to divide and rule over the day and rule over the night in the physical dimension.

Conclusion

Physical creation must be preceded by the possibility of its existence. However, even a possibility must itself also consist of something in order to possess potential. Essential components of  physical possibilities must be based on spiritual axioms, which would include unchanging principles and laws.

Not mentioned heretofore, however, is the essential component of possibility, which if absent, possibility itself could not exist. That component would be energy. There must be a source of energy for any possibility to be realized and come into being. Indeed, because for any physical creation to come into being, there must be action, and action requires energy.  

A force of energy has always existed. This force is the source and foundation of all things that be, or can be. It is what makes even possibilities possible. All of the things afore mentioned are in God. God said, “I Am”.

Everything physically existing is being spun into existence by the wisdom, knowledge, and understanding of God. And everything in the physical realm consists of energy, including matter which is also a form of energy.

From being possibilities, all things that we now see have come to be. Two final elements in the process, however, need to be given more attention; and that would be purpose and design. Purpose and design are absolutely necessary for highly complex designs to be viable. Even evolution would be dependent upon purpose to be successful. Otherwise, there is no design and random mutations with no direction and no consistent shape or form would overwhelm viability and creative chaos would be the rule.

Design requires intent, and intent requires purpose. A house or an automobile is not going to design and build itself. Even more daunting would be the creation of biological life and the universe. The seeing eye for example would not exist without design, nor design without purpose.

Thus, the debate becomes one over the designer. Either self designing mutations somehow found order out of need as they went along making relatively few mistakes, or an omnipotent Creator with knowledge, intent, and purpose designed and created all things.

I for one am certain of the latter.  God, in his willingness to make visible all the invisible things from before the foundations of the world, said, "Let there be Light". Those are the first recorded words spoken by God. Light is knowledge. And God created all things to make knowledge manifest. Indeed, in so doing, all of creation is a witness which testifies of the invisible knowledge of God. Creation then is the teaching apparatus of God. And there is nothing that was created without an intended purpose to illustrate things that otherwise would not be known to those whom he created.
